One of the UK’s hottest airports might quickly hike car park fees as half of an formidable plan to secure a second runway. Gatwick Airport bosses haven’t ruled out rising car park drop-off fees and parking tariffs to pressure people to use the trains.

The transfer comes as half of a bid to secure planning permission to construct a second runway on the website. Gatwick believes a second runway would add an additional 100,000 flights per yr and will nearly double the airport’s capability to 75m passengers. The Planning Inspectorate has beforehand stated Gatwick should be certain that at the least 54% of travellers use public transport to get the inexperienced gentle for a second runway.

However, the choice is probably going to be unpopular amongst holidaymakers who may very well be compelled to splash out to head overseas.

Stewart Wingate, chief govt of Gatwick Airport, pressured car park fees had been in the highlight as bosses had no control over how many people used the trains.

Stewart stated: “We’d be making an attempt to affect people who had been making that marginal resolution of ‘should I drive and drop off or use the car parks, or should I use the rail services?

“The forecourt drop-off charge is the mechanism we can use. We could start to increase that drop-off charge. If we adjust that upwards we would also make changes to the car parking tariffs as well.”

Any higher increases could make Gatwick Airport London’s costliest airport for parking fees. 

Heathrow Airport prices street customers £6 to stop with Stansted’s drop-off fees presently costing £7.

Stewart added: “We’re trying to give the Government a pragmatic, sensible and rational pathway which achieves the objective of reduced road congestion and allows them to support the runway.”
